合計(jì) 10000 件の関連コンテンツが見つかりました
PHPアプリケーションでのSQL注入攻撃を防ぐ方法は?
記事の紹介:この記事では、PHPアプリケーションでのSQL注入攻撃を防ぐ方法について詳しく説明しています。 入力検証と安全なコーディングプラクティスによって補(bǔ)足された、パラメーター化されたクエリを一次防御として強(qiáng)調(diào)しています。 この記事では、有益なPHP LIBRについても説明しています
2025-03-10
コメント 0
490
PHPでのSQL注入をどのように防止しますか? (準(zhǔn)備された聲明、PDO)
記事の紹介:PHPで前処理ステートメントとPDOを使用すると、SQL注入攻撃を効果的に防ぐことができます。 1)PDOを使用してデータベースに接続し、エラーモードを設(shè)定します。 2)準(zhǔn)備方法を使用して前処理ステートメントを作成し、プレースホルダーを使用してデータを渡し、メソッドを?qū)g行します。 3)結(jié)果のクエリを処理し、コードのセキュリティとパフォーマンスを確保します。
2025-04-15
コメント 0
720
PHP 7でのSQL注入攻撃を防ぐ方法は?
記事の紹介:この記事では、PHP 7でのSQLインジェクション攻撃を防ぐ方法を詳しく説明しています。コア引數(shù)は、SQLのユーザーデータの直接埋め込みを回避し、主要な防御としてパラメーター化されたクエリと準(zhǔn)備されたステートメントを強(qiáng)調(diào)しています。 補(bǔ)足戦略には含まれます
2025-03-10
コメント 0
1118
依存関係の注入とは何ですか?また、PHPで使用するにはどうすればよいですか?
記事の紹介:依存関係注射(DI)は、コードの柔軟性とテスト能力を向上させるために使用される設(shè)計(jì)パターンです。 1.內(nèi)部作成ではなく、外部から依存関係を提供することにより、結(jié)合を減らします。 2。PHPでは、DIは通常、コンストラクターまたはセッターメソッドを介して実裝されます。 3. DIを使用すると、テスト可能性、柔軟性、および個(gè)別の懸念を改善できます。 4。依存関係は、実際の使用中にコンテナを介して自動(dòng)的に解決できます。 5.ただし、DIは簡単なスクリプトやパフォーマンスに敏感なシナリオでは使用できません。
2025-06-26
コメント 0
650
SQL注入とは何ですか、PHP MySQLでそれを防ぐ方法
記事の紹介:sqlinuctionSaseCurityvulnerabilitywhereattactersInjectMalicioussqlcodeIntoinputfields、LeadingtounAuthorizedAccessordatatheft.itoccurswhenuserinputisdirectlyconcationcateNatedIntosqlireSwithoutValidationSonitization.
2025-07-11
コメント 0
655
PHPアプリケーションでのSQL注入をどのように防止しますか?
記事の紹介:それらを使用してください。Qlinjectionsisisisisisising reparedStatementswitheTateMetariesizedQueries、whatesureuserinputistreatedasdata、notexecutablecode.first、use -prepared -statementsviapdoomysqli、bindinputvalueSecuretoplaceholderthinte
2025-07-17
コメント 0
353
セキュリティの脆弱性を防ぐために、PHP メーラーでのユーザー入力をサニタイズする方法
記事の紹介:PHP メーラーでのユーザー入力のサニタイズユーザーがフォームを通じて PHP メーラーに入力を送信する場(chǎng)合、悪意のあるコードの実行やインジェクション攻撃を防ぐために、送信前に入力をサニタイズすることが重要です。問題: 次の PHP メーラー スクリプトを考えてみましょう。
2024-10-18
コメント 0
921
PHP 8のSQL注入攻撃を防ぐにはどうすればよいですか?
記事の紹介:この記事では、PHP 8でのSQLインジェクション攻撃を防ぐ方法について詳しく説明しています。これは、厳密な入力検証と消毒とともに、プライマリディフェンスとしてパラメーター化されたクエリ/準(zhǔn)備されたステートメントを強(qiáng)調(diào)しています。 ベストプラクティスには、最小特権PRIが含まれます
2025-03-10
コメント 0
366
PHPでのSQL注入攻撃を防ぐにはどうすればよいですか?
記事の紹介:bestwaytopreventsqlinjectionInphpisusingpisusisingswithtatementswithetarizedqueriesviapdoormysqli.1.definesqlStructurefirst、thenbindvariablesseparytally、sursuringurininputistreatedasdata、notexecutableda.2.validateandateandsanitizealinputss.g.g.gのvalidateandtateandsaniteantizealinputs
2025-06-27
コメント 0
625
CakePHP 上の DI コンテナ
記事の紹介:モチベーション
DIコンテナでCommandとControllerにServiceを注入したい。
また、Service は注入された Repository を使用します。
このドキュメントでは、ネストされたインジェクションのようなこのケースについては言及されていません。
書類
https://book.cakephp.org/4/en/devel
2024-12-24
コメント 0
940
PHP Webアプリケーションの一般的なセキュリティの脆弱性とそれらを防ぐ方法について話し合います。
記事の紹介:PHPアプリケーションの一般的なセキュリティの脆弱性には、SQLインジェクション、XSS、ファイルアップロード脆弱性、およびCSRFが含まれます。 1.前処理ステートメントは、SQL注入を防止し、SQL文字列のスプライシングを避け、入力のチェックサムフィルタリングを避けるために使用する必要があります。 2.出力前にXSSがコンテンツを逃げ、適切なHTTPヘッダーを設(shè)定し、ユーザーの入力を信頼しないことを防ぎます。 3.ファイルアップロードの脆弱性を防止して、ファイルの種類を確認(rèn)し、ファイルの名前を変更し、アップロードディレクトリがスクリプトの実行を禁止します。 4. CSRFを防ぐと、1回限りのトークンを使用し、參照者とオリジンのヘッダーをチェックし、機(jī)密操作のためのPOSTリクエストを使用する必要があります。開発中にセキュリティ認(rèn)識(shí)を強(qiáng)化する必要があり、フレームワークの組み込みメカニズムを合理的に使用してセキュリティを改善する必要があります。
2025-07-11
コメント 0
515